Abstract
Artificial intelligence has the potential to lead to dramatic enhancements in patient care, research, and education across numerous disciplines within medicine. One field that is known for its history of continual innovation and creativity is plastic and reconstructive surgery. To that end, the promise of artificial intelligence and associated technologies is large within plastic surgery. Various forms of artificial intelligence, including machine learning, data analytics (i.e., big data), robotics, and computer vision, have already been utilized in the clinical environment. However, much additional work in the form of ideation, development, and implementation—as well as subsequent testing—is required for widespread clinical use. This chapter will address the current uses as well as future directions of artificial intelligence in plastic surgery.
